Meghan Markle and Prince Harry have “massive reservations” about “Spare”

  • Meghan Markle and Prince Harry have reservations about Prince Harry’s upcoming memoir, royal expert Eric Schiffer said.
  • The couple are worried about the impact the book will have on their relationship.
  • Schiffer says they hope to avoid an “all-out war” with the royal family.

Meghan Markle and Prince Harry have’massive reservations’ about the Duke of Sussex’s upcoming memoir Spare, which will be released just months later, according to a royal expert.

The Duke and Duchess of Sussex are preparing for major projects in the coming year, including their Netflix docuseries, but it is Prince Harry’s memoir that has the couple worried about the impact it will have on their relationship with the royal family, according to royal expert Eric Schiffer.

Talking to an interview, Schiffer said, “I’m sure that they have massive reservations about the biography. Harry does, because of how it could blow up and create spontaneous combustion with their relationship at its current point, being so unstable.”

“Harry is becoming less relevant in this new power structure with Charles. Any choices you would have made under the Queen if you’re at Harry’s camp or Meghan’s camp, are being rethought, including how those messages are getting communicated,” Schiffer explained.

The expert went on to say that while Meghan and Prince Harry hope to avoid a “all-out war” with the royals, the contents of Harry’s book may be making them nervous so close to the release date; Harry’s book is scheduled to be released on January 10, 2023.
